**Fan-out Backpressure (Brindlehook Notify)**

When a notification fan-out exceeds the per-plugin delivery budget, Brindlehook Notify applies backpressure by returning a 429 with a `X-Drain-After` header rather than dropping events. Plugin authors should pause enqueueing until the drain window elapses, then resume at half the prior rate. To inspect your current budget and queue depth, call the internal quota service, authenticating with the key below:

app token of hawif-yaguf = kto15_D1YHEykrtxKxx7V

# Haulgrid Environments: Fleet Fuel-Usage Report Service

Plugin authors targeting the Haulgrid fuel-usage report API should note that each environment (sandbox, staging, production) exposes identical endpoints but different aggregation windows and rate limits. Sandbox data is synthetic and refreshed nightly. Your plugin must read settings at startup rather than hardcoding them. The active environment configuration is listed below.

service settings:
PRAIX_LOG_LEVEL=error
PRAIX_METRICS_HOST=metrics.praix.qorvelcorp.corp
PRAIX_POOL_SIZE=16

### Capacity note: undo/redo history in Quillboard

For the security review: undo/redo stacks in the Quillboard diagram editor are held in memory per session and capped to bound both RAM and replay-attack surface. Snapshots are delta-encoded; full checkpoints occur periodically. Nothing persists server-side beyond the session TTL. The caps governing history depth and checkpoint cadence are as follows.

constants for tafog-kahag:
RATE_LIMITS = {
    "sorir": 697,
    "oliox": 683,
    "holax": 176,
    "casox": 60,
    "pelius": 382,
}

Subject: Key rotation for BranchSweeper bot

Hi team,

As part of our quarterly credential hygiene at Lontra Systems, we've rotated the API key that BranchSweeper uses to query the merge-status service before deleting stale branches. The old key stops working Friday at noon. Please verify any review automation you maintain still passes after the swap. The new key for the merge-status service is below.

API key for tagef-fafop: vxb2-ta